EDI核心文件监控与处理源码 CCS.zip 解读

版权申诉
0 下载量 187 浏览量 更新于2024-11-05 收藏 24KB ZIP 举报
资源摘要信息: "CCS.zip_edi" 根据所提供的文件信息,以下是对【标题】、【描述】和【压缩包子文件的文件名称列表】中涉及的关键知识点的详细说明: 标题 "CCS.zip_edi" 暗示了一个与电子数据交换(EDI)相关的压缩包文件。EDI是一种标准化的电子通信方式,用于将业务文档(如订单、发票、货运通知等)从一方的计算机系统传输到另一方的计算机系统。文件标题中的 "CCS" 可能代表某种核心代码库或软件包名称,而 "_edi" 明确指出该代码包或软件包是专门为EDI任务设计的。 描述 "This is the core source for reliable inbound file watching and processing needed for edi." 说明了这个压缩包内含的文件是实现EDI业务流程中文件监控和处理的核心源代码。"Reliable inbound file watching" 指的是对传入的文件进行监视,确保一旦有新的文件到达,系统能即时发现并采取行动。"Processing" 则是指对文件内容进行解析、验证、转换或执行其他相关业务逻辑的过程。整个描述强调了文件监控和处理对于EDI流程的重要性,同时也表明这个核心源代码是可靠性的关键所在。 标签 "edi" 直接指向了文件内容的主题,即电子数据交换。在IT领域,标签通常用于分类和检索,因此这个标签帮助用户快速识别文件内容与EDI相关,便于查找和使用。 压缩包子文件的文件名称列表包括三个具体的文件或组件:FirstData.FileWatcherService、CCS.FDR、CCS.Core。 1. FirstData.FileWatcherService:从名称来看,这个组件可能是专门设计来监控文件系统中的文件变化事件。它可能是通过轮询或使用文件系统通知(如Windows的ReadDirectoryChangesW API或Linux的inotify机制)来实现的。该服务组件对于EDI场景来说非常重要,因为它确保了对传入文件的实时监视,这通常是一个EDI系统的关键要求。 ***S.FDR:尽管文件列表没有提供这一组件的具体描述,但"CCS"可能代表的是同一核心源代码包的其他部分,而"FDR"可能是指文件数据记录(File Data Record)或文件描述记录(File Description Record),这在处理EDI文件时是重要的概念,涉及到文件格式和结构的定义。在一个EDI系统中,FDR可能负责存储有关文件接收、存储和处理的元数据信息。 ***S.Core:这个组件很可能是整个EDI软件包的底层核心框架。它可能包含了所有的基础功能,比如日志记录、配置管理、错误处理、数据转换引擎、通信协议实现等。在软件开发中,"Core" 组件通常指代支持软件运行和提供必要功能的那部分代码。 综合这些知识点,我们可以看出 "CCS.zip_edi" 是一个为EDI任务准备的、包含核心源代码的压缩包,其中涉及关键组件如文件监控服务、文件数据记录以及核心框架。这个包对于需要处理大量业务数据交换、确保数据准确性及符合行业标准的组织来说,是一个宝贵的资源。它能够帮助开发团队快速构建出能够有效处理EDI文件传输和处理的应用程序。